Minimum Qualifications & Experience: 

  • Behavioral Case Manager I: Education and Experience requirements at this level consists of a High School Diploma, General Equivalency Diploma (GED), or High School Equivalency (HSE) Credential and six (6) months of behavioral health experience. 

  • Behavioral Case Manager II: Thirty-six (36) months of direct, documented experience working with persons with mental illness and/or substance use disorder and possess a High School Diploma or equivalent or 

  • Sixty (60) college credit hours and have a minimum of twelve (12) months of direct, documented experience working with persons with mental illness and/or substance use disorder or 

  • Bachelor's or Master's degree in any field and have a minimum of six (6) months of direct, documented experience working with persons with mental illness and/or substance use disorder or 

  • Have a Bachelor's or Master's degree in a behavioral health related field or 

  • Have a current license as a registered nurse in the State of Oklahoma with documented experience in behavioral health care. 

  • Senior Behavioral Case Manager II  Same Minimum Qualification as a Behavioral Case Manager II plus 2 additional years of experience as a case manager.

About Us: 

Griffin Memorial Hospital (GMH) is an ODMHSAS treatment center serving all 77 counties in Oklahoma. We specialize in community crisis stabilization and residential treatment for individuals facing substance abuse, co-occurring mental health disorders, and trauma-related conditions.

About State of Oklahoma

The Oklahoma State Department of Health, through its system of local health services delivery, is ultimately responsible for protecting and improving the public's health status through strategies that focus on preventing disease. Four major service branches, Community and Family Health Services, Wellness Programs, Disease, Prevention and Preparedness Services and Protective Health Services, provide technical support and guidance to 68 county health departments as well as guidance and consultation to the two independent city-county health departments in Oklahoma City and Tulsa.
